Nine-year-old Gabby Torres is the star of this new graphic novel series! Join Gabby as she navigates the inevitable disasters of fourth grade and social media, perfect for fans of Katie the Catsitter and Allergic.

This heartwarming series is written and illustrated by Angela Dominguez, the New York Times bestselling illustrator who created the beloved Stella Díaz series. Gabby Torres is tenacious, bold, relatable, and hilarious, reminiscent of favorite characters like Junie B. Jones, Clementine, and Ramona Quimby.

Gabby Torres is the Best Winner Ever!

Roaring Brook
Pub Date: 12/2/25
Book 2 in the Gabby Torres Series!

Gabby has a new idea: now that she’s finally learned how to not burn her cookies, she will become the best baker the world has ever seen!

The local grocery store's baking competition is the perfect opportunity to show everyone what she’s made of… winner material!

All she needs to do is buy books for research and baking supplies... and more baking supplies... and more baking supplies... oh dear.

What will happen when her money, and her parents’ patience, runs out?

Stella Díaz Has Something To Say

Roaring Brook Press
Available in Paperback & Audiobook
Book 1 in the Stella Díaz Series!

A New York Public Library Best Book for Kids 2018
Top 10 Showstopper Favorite
One of Chicago Public Library’s “Best of Best Books 2018”
2019 Sid Fleischmann Award winner
A 2019 ALSC Notable Children’s Book
2019 Global Read Aloud Choice
Sunshine State Young Readers Award List 2019-2020
Maryland Blue Crab Young Readers Honor 2019

“Fans of Clementine and Alvin Ho will be delighted to meet Stella.”  
- School Library Journal (starred review)

“Drawing on her own childhood, Dominguez smoothly blends Spanish and English into the narration and dialogue, Stella’s Mexican-American culture fully informs her perspective and family life, and chunky spot art helps establish the setting. Readers should easily relate to Stella, her struggle to use her voice, and the way she feels caught between worlds at school and at home.”
- Publishers Weekly

“Dominguez’s novel introduces a character many readers can relate to, especially bilingual kids or English language learners who struggle with expressing themselves. An excellent, empowering addition to middle grade collections.” 
- Booklist

“A nice and timely depiction of an immigrant child experience.” 
- Kirkus Reviews

“Readers will agree with Stella’s mother and brother that she is, as her name suggests, a star.” 
- BCCB

“Many readers will relate to and sympathize with the protagonist. Lively interspersed black-and-white illustrations showing elements of Stella’s day-to-day life and of her imagination add dimension to a rich narrative.”
- The Horn Book
